BJP's popularity on ground rising: Kishan

HYDERABAD: The BJP on Saturday declared that the party was gaining strength at the ground level and that it did not place much stock on other parties holding ‘high profile’ events to admit defectors. It said that it was steadily increasing its presence at the ground level, with local level leaders from other parties were lining up to join the BJP.

State BJP president G. Kishan Reddy said, “This effort was being led by Etala Rajendar, chairman of the BJP’s joinings committee. Many local important leaders are joining the BJP, and under his leadership, we will draw up a schedule for more such event.”

Kishan Reddy was addressing a gathering at the party headquarters where a large number of leaders from different caste groups, and others, followers of M. Jaipal Reddy, son of M. Baga Reddy, former Congress leader from Medak district, joined the BJP.

Rajendar said, “The BJP does not believe in ‘artificial boosting’ of the party by making a show of some ‘high-profile’ joinings, but is working from the ground up. In the next few days, there will be hundreds more of such joinings at meetings that will be held at the constituency level, he added.

Kishan Reddy criticised Chief Minister K. Chandrashekar Rao for arresting party leaders and workers from Kamareddy who were headed for Gajwel, the CM’s constituency, to check on the BRS claims of development “Is Gajwel the private property of KCR? Was it bequeathed to him either by the Nizam or Owaisi,” Kishan Reddy asked.

Declaring that “the BJP is ready for anything,” Kishan Reddy said the BJP is not intimidated by use of force by the BRS government and restricting his party’s people from moving freely in the state.
